Abstract

The integrated circuit has a functional assembly, such as a memory, and a configuration assembly for configuring the functional assembly. The inputs of the configuration assembly can be connected to the control voltage via at least one integrated switch. On the control side, the switch is connected to an evaluation circuit, which, on the input side, is connected to at least one pad. The evaluation circuit detects a configuration signal present at the pad and converts it into a control signal for the switch.

Claims

exact text as granted — not AI-modified
I claim: 
     
       1. An integrated circuit, comprising: a plurality of pads for contacting the integrated circuit;   a functional assembly of the integrated circuit and a configuration assembly connected to said functional assembly for configuring said functional assembly, said configuration assembly having control inputs for receiving at least one control voltage;   at least one integrated switch connected between said control inputs of said configuration assembly and a control voltage source, said integrated switch having a control side connection;   an evaluation circuit having an input side connected to at least one of said plurality of pads and an output side connected to said control side connection of said switch, said evaluation circuit detecting a configuration signal present at said at least one pad and applying a control signal for said switch.   
     
     
       2. The circuit according to claim 1, wherein said pads are adapted to be contacted by bonding. 
     
     
       3. The circuit according to claim 1, wherein said functional assembly is a memory. 
     
     
       4. The circuit according to claim 1, which comprises a non-volatile memory for storing the control signal connected between said switch and said evaluation circuit. 
     
     
       5. The circuit according to claim 1, wherein said evaluation circuit is adapted to detect and convert an analog input signal. 
     
     
       6. The circuit according to claim 1, wherein said evaluation circuit is connected to a plurality of said pads. 
     
     
       7. The circuit according to claim 1, wherein said switch is a transistor. 
     
     
       8. The circuit according to claim 1, which comprises a flash memory cell for storing the control signal connected between said switch and said evaluation circuit. 
     
     
       9. An integrated circuit device, comprising the circuit according to claim 1, a lead frame having pins contact-connected to said pads, and a housing commonly encapsulating said circuit and said lead frame.
